#f947d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f947dc is composed of 97.6% red, 27.8%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.5%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 309.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 62.7%. #f947d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#f300b9.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f947dc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f947dc has RGB values of R:249, G:71,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.12,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16336860.

Hex triplet f947dc #f947dc
RGB Decimal 249, 71, 220 rgb(249,71,220)
RGB Percent 97.6, 27.8, 86.3 rgb(97.6%,27.8%,86.3%)
CMYK 0, 71, 12, 2
HSL 309.8°, 93.7, 62.7 hsl(309.8,93.7%,62.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 309.8°, 71.5, 97.6
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 61.496, 80.687, -39.495
XYZ 54.238, 29.818, 70.605
xyY 0.351, 0.193, 29.818
CIE-LCH 61.496, 89.835, 333.919
CIE-LUV 61.496, 84.987, -73.65
Hunter-Lab 54.605, 81.739, -38.438
Binary 11111001, 01000111, 11011100

Shades and Tints of #f947d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060005 is the darkest color, while #fff2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f947d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19fa1 is the less saturated color, while #f947dc is the most saturated one.
